The following photos were taken at Red Deer Reptiles on November 9, 2008. Unfortunately, my phone did not take clear pictures, but they are clear enough that you can get an idea as to how poor the conditions were:
A kingsnake with no water and a
filthy enclosure:
Another kingsnake that appears
extremely malnourished:
A rainbow boa in a completely dry enclosure with a bone dry water dish:
A bearded dragon (which was in pretty rough shape, although I couldn't get a clear shot of it) soaking in its waterdish with
filthy water:
A poor shot of a Kenyan Sand Boa that is strongly suspected to be dead. We watched it for about 5 minutes and never once saw it take a breath. Numerous attempts to 'prevoke' it into moving even a little bit were unsuccessful:
Pictures that didn't come out as clear included shots of Amazon Tree Boas either resting on the bottom of the cage as a result of not having pearches or soaking in a waterdish, and several enclosures infested with mites.
The majority of the reptiles in the store were soaking in their waterdishes, which contained disgusting water. Scorpions that were labelled as "Lethal" were kept in containers that were within reach of small children.
I saw heat tape underneath several enclosures; however, all of the heat tape I touched was cool and it did not appear to be turned on.
